What is Bacterial Motility: Detection Methods and Types about?
Motility refers to the movement of bacteria and microorganisms, primarily facilitated by flagella. Detection methods include microscopic techniques like the hanging drop method and non-microscopic methods such as semi-solid agar media. True motility involves directional movement, while false motility includes passive drifting and Brownian movement, with various bacteria exhibiting distinct motility types.
